I accidentally uncovered a chipmunk nest while I was moving some flat rocks in my front yard. It was a small tunnel totally lined with chewed tree leaves. A pile of sunflower seeds and peanuts were stashed at each end. The baby chipmunk was lying in the middle - his eyes not quite opening yet. After I got this shot, I carefully placed the rocks back over the nest.
